More Provisioning woes


  • Subject: More Provisioning woes
  • From: Rick Mann <email@hidden>
  • Date: Thu, 08 Sep 2016 15:33:58 -0700

Today a bunch of our Profiles expired. Normally I just re-generate them, but now I can't. The Portal says they all lack Certificates. Thing is, we still have two Certificates (one for each developer), that have NOT expired, in the Portal.

To confuse matters further, the one Profile that has not yet expired contains those two developer Certificates and seems fine with them.

I was able to make a new Development Certificate for myself, but now I have two in the Portal. That new one is acceptable to the Portal for the Profiles.

Has something changed? What's happening here? Googling only turned up very old similar questions.
